Pocket door repair services involve fixing or restoring sliding doors that are installed within a wall, rather than swinging open like traditional doors. These services typically address issues related to the door’s movement, alignment, or functionality, ensuring that the pocket door slides smoothly and stays securely in place. Repair work may include replacing damaged rollers, realigning the track, fixing broken or worn-out hardware, or addressing problems with the door’s frame. Professional contractors focus on restoring the door’s proper operation, helping homeowners regain privacy and maximize space efficiency in their homes.

Common problems that pocket door repair services help resolve include sticking or jamming doors, doors that fall off their tracks, or doors that won’t open or close completely. Over time, wear and tear can cause rollers to become misaligned or break, tracks to become bent or dirty, or hardware to loosen. These issues can lead to noisy operation, difficulty opening or closing, or even damage to the surrounding wall or door frame. Repair specialists can diagnose the root cause of these problems and perform the necessary adjustments or replacements to restore full functionality.

Pocket door repair services are often needed in residential properties such as homes with limited space, where traditional swinging doors may not be practical. They are also common in apartments, condominiums, and smaller houses where maximizing usable space is a priority. Additionally, older homes with original pocket doors may require repairs due to aging hardware or structural shifts. These services can also be useful in commercial properties like offices or retail spaces that utilize pocket doors for room separation or privacy, helping to maintain a smooth and quiet operation.

The overview below groups typical Pocket Door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Nampa, ID.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Many routine pocket door repairs, such as minor track adjustments or latch fixes, typically cost between $150 and $400. These projects are common and usually involve straightforward work that local contractors can handle efficiently.

Moderate Repairs - More involved repairs like replacing damaged rollers or fixing door alignment often range from $400 to $800. Projects in this range are quite frequent and may require some additional parts or labor time.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ire pocket door assembly can cost between $1,000 and $2,500, depending on the door style and complexity. Larger, more complex projects like full replacements are less common but handled regularly by local pros.

Custom or Complex Projects - Larger or custom installations, such as installing new pocket door systems in renovated spaces, can exceed $3,000 and reach $5,000+ in some cases. These projects are less frequent but are within the scope of experienced local contractors for suitable jobs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common issues with pocket doors that need repair? Common problems include misalignment, difficulty sliding, broken tracks, or damaged door panels that may require professional assessment and repair.

How can local contractors fix a stuck pocket door? Service providers can inspect the track and rollers, realign or replace components, and ensure smooth operation of the door.

What causes a pocket door to come off its track? Causes often include worn rollers, warped tracks, or improper installation, which can be addressed by experienced repair professionals.

Are there ways to prevent pocket door issues? Regular maintenance, such as cleaning tracks and checking hardware, can help prevent common problems and extend the lifespan of the door.

How do repair services handle damaged door panels on pocket doors? Local contractors can replace or repair damaged panels, ensuring the door functions properly and maintains its appearance.
